Ingredients
Scale
- 3-4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ts
- 1 medium onion
- 3 cloves fresh garlic
- 1 can (14.5 oz) diced tomatoes
- 4 cups low-sodium chicken broth
- 1 cup enchilada sauce
- Optional toppings: cheese, cilantro, sour cream
Instructions
- In a large pot, heat oil over medium heat; sauté diced onion until translucent. Add minced garlic and cook until fragrant.
- Add chicken breasts, season with salt and pepper, and pour enough chicken broth to cover the chicken completely. Bring to a boil.
- Once cooked (15-20 minutes), remove chicken and shred it using two forks; return to the pot.
- Stir in diced tomatoes and enchilada sauce; simmer on low heat for 10 minutes.
- For creaminess, mix in sour cream or cream cheese until smooth.
- Serve hot with your choice of toppings.
Notes
Customize the spice level by using spicy enchilada sauce or adding jalapeños.
To save time, prep vegetables and cook chicken ahead of time.
